VMware has announced an expansion of its hybrid cloud hosting service into Asia-Pacific with two new partnerships, in Japan and China. By the end of 2014, VMware operated clouds are expected to be available in over 75% of the world’s cloud market.
In Japan, VMware announced a joint venture with SoftBank which launches the software vendor’s first vCloud Hybrid Service in Asia. This cloud hosting service is available now as a private beta and will become generally available in Q4 of this year.
In China, VMware has announced plans with China Telecom for China Telecom to build a hybrid cloud hosting service in Beijing leveraging VMware’s technology.
